**Ticket PSK-218: Config drift in ScaleWhisk calculator**

Hey plugin authors — staging and prod have drifted on the recipe-scaling calculator's rounding and unit-conversion settings, so your plugins may behave differently between environments. We're re-syncing tonight; please don't hardcode workarounds in the meantime. For reference, the intended canonical configuration is the following.

settings of kawig-kahip:
ULAETH_PIN=4988
ULAETH_TENANT=briath
ULAETH_METRICS_HOST=metrics.ulaeth.xolmarworks.test
ULAETH_SEAL=seal_e1a2fe42
ULAETH_STANDBY_TEAM=pelix

Handover from the Veritail validator plugin work: the registry now hot-loads third-party validators, but version pinning isn't enforced yet, so mismatched plugins can fail silently at startup. Check the loader log first when customers report skipped validations. I've documented every known failure mode, the temporary workaround, and the rollout checklist on the internal page below.

dashboard of tahop-fahof = https://harbor.tolvaqnet.example/secrets/merge_requests/board/issue/merge_requests/pipeline/secrets/ecb30ed86a55c001a77f6cb9

Handover: Meridrop cron drift follow-up

To whoever picks this up: plugin authors reported their scheduled validators firing late on the Meridrop platform. Root cause was the host clock stepping after suspend; the scheduler never re-anchored. I shipped a re-anchor hook — plugin authors should call it on resume rather than trusting wall-clock deltas. Remaining task: verify the sealed drift logs match the hook's corrections. Those logs are in the encrypted handover bundle, and the passphrase to open it is below.

strongbox words: zorwyn-sorael-belion-ulaius-silmir-ulays-briax-rusdor-gorix

Quarterly Planning Note — Divestiture of the Coastal Tooling Unit

For the finance team: the sale of the Coastal Tooling unit to Pellmark Industries remains on track for close in Q3. Please finalize the carve-out balance sheet, reconcile intercompany positions, and prepare the working-capital adjustment schedule by month-end. Audit support requests should be prioritized. For planning purposes, note the following sensitive item:

internal memo for hawef-kahif: The finance team signed off on a budget of $25.9 million for Project Sorox. The renewal with Pelokek Logistics closes at $51.7 million a year, 52 percent below the last contract.